Output ed8d30d9a8cdc3883da3e6bf1f33b70b37ca76ac5a84fc5670e0d0ec50d56a36:43

value
504678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d030a7a19cc90498f8bc456bec24cc7a8b911cb OP_EQUAL
address
3MqcuE2orvznDbdBbUH8XL3BSXzoAMsNNv
transaction
ed8d30d9a8cdc3883da3e6bf1f33b70b37ca76ac5a84fc5670e0d0ec50d56a36
spent
true